fullmoon-3 님의 블로그

fullmoon-3 님의 블로그 입니다.

  • 2025. 4. 24.

    by. fullmoon-3

    목차

       

      OpenAI API를 처음 사용하는 분들을 위한 필수 가이드입니다. GPT-4, DALL·E, Whisper 등의 모델을 어떻게 호출하고 활용할 수 있는지, 그리고 각 API의 가격 체계까지 알기 쉽게 정리했습니다.

       

       

       

       

       

      1. OpenAI API란 무엇인가?

      OpenAI API는 ChatGPT, GPT-4, DALL·E, Whisper 등 강력한 AI 모델을 외부 애플리케이션에서 활용할 수 있도록 해주는 인터페이스입니다. 간단히 말해, OpenAI가 만든 AI 기술을 웹사이트나 앱에 쉽게 연동할 수 있는 도구입니다.

      2. OpenAI API 주요 모델 종류

      모델 설명 주요 활용
      GPT-4 / GPT-3.5 자연어 처리용 대형 언어모델 챗봇, 문서 요약, 자동 응답
      DALL·E 텍스트 → 이미지 생성 콘텐츠 제작, 디자인 도구
      Whisper 음성 → 텍스트 변환 회의록, 자막 생성 등
      Embedding 문장/단어 → 벡터값 검색 최적화, 추천 시스템

      3. OpenAI API 사용을 위한 준비 단계

      4. OpenAI API 연동 방법 (Python 예제)

      import openai
      
      openai.api_key = "sk-xxxxxxxxxxxxxxxx"
      
      response = openai.ChatCompletion.create(
        model="gpt-4",
        messages=[{"role": "user", "content": "Hello, GPT!"}]
      )
      
      print(response['choices'][0]['message']['content'])

      ※ API 키는 외부에 노출되면 안 되므로 보안에 유의하세요.

      5. OpenAI API 요금제 및 가격 구조 (2024년 기준)

      모델 가격 (1,000 tokens 기준) 요약
      GPT-4-8K $0.03 (입력) / $0.06 (출력) 고정밀, 고비용
      GPT-4-32K $0.06 (입력) / $0.12 (출력) 긴 문맥 처리
      GPT-3.5 Turbo $0.0015 (입력) / $0.002 (출력) 가성비 탁월
      DALL·E 이미지 1장 생성당 $0.02 이미지 출력
      Whisper 1분 오디오당 약 $0.006 음성 인식

      공식 가격표 바로가기

      6. 요금 계산 시 유의사항

      • Token이란? 한 단어의 일부 혹은 짧은 문장을 의미하며, 영어 기준 약 750단어 = 1,000 tokens
      • 한국어는 토큰 수가 더 많아지는 경향이 있으므로 요금이 증가할 수 있습니다.
      • 출력 토큰도 과금 대상이므로 응답 길이도 고려해야 합니다.

      7. 무료 사용 가능 여부와 팁

      • 신규 가입자: 일정량 무료 크레딧 제공 (보통 $5~$18)
      • 학생/비영리단체: 별도 신청 시 지원 가능
      • 요금 한도 설정 기능을 꼭 활용하여 과금 방지

      8. 마무리 및 추천 리소스

      OpenAI API는 막강한 성능과 유연성을 자랑하지만, 요금 체계가 조금 복잡할 수 있습니다. 사용 목적과 예산에 맞는 모델을 선택하고, API 호출 횟수와 토큰량을 조절하는 것이 핵심입니다.